Express Installation
Express installation is for users who have little experience or are evaluating the
product. It makes assumptions about such things as port number and which
components to install.
The following table lists the assumptions made by the Express installation. If you
would like to usedifferent installation settings, use Typical or Custom installation.
Table 2-1 Express installation settings
Installation Setting Value
administration port 8888
administration URL http://machine name:administration port
HTTP port number 80
document root server_root/doc
UNIX user to run server root
